CRM for law firms

Client intake, matter tracking, and follow-up CRM picks for law firms โ€” not full practice-management or billing suites.

Important

For client intake and follow-up โ€” not legal practice management (billing, trust accounting, court calendaring).

For most firms the leak isn't billing โ€” Clio, MyCase, or PracticePanther already track matters and trust accounting. The leak is intake: leads that call after hours, consultations that never get a follow-up, and referral sources nobody is nurturing. A few hours' delay on a personal-injury or family-law inquiry is often the whole case lost to the firm that called back first.

The CRMs below are picked for legal intake specifically: fast lead capture and speed-to-lead, conflict-aware contact handling, and follow-up cadences for consultations and referrals โ€” feeding your practice-management system rather than duplicating it.

What matters for law firms

  • Speed-to-lead: instant auto-response and routing for after-hours inquiries
  • Intake forms and e-signature for engagement letters, not just generic deals
  • Conflict-check-friendly contact fields before a matter is opened
  • Referral-source tracking so you know which attorneys and clients send work
  • Syncs to Clio / MyCase / PracticePanther instead of replacing matter management

Common questions

  • Do I still need Clio or MyCase if I get a CRM?

    Yes. Practice-management software remains your system of record for matters, time, billing, and trust accounting. The CRM owns the pre-engagement stage โ€” intake, speed-to-lead, and referral nurturing โ€” then hands the signed client off to it.

  • How does a CRM help with conflict checks?

    It can't render an ethics opinion, but it captures opposing-party and related-entity fields at intake and flags potential matches before you open a matter โ€” surfacing the conflict early instead of after the engagement letter is signed.
